Aplysia oculifera Adams & Reeves, 1850
Location: Woody Point, Redcliffe Peninsula, Queensland, Australia
Size: 80 mm
Depth: Intertidal
Temperature: 20 C
ORDER: ANASPIDEA
FAMILY: Aplysiidae

This species is normally brown with irregular white splotches all over its body (as on the head of this individual).
This individual is atypical in having some dark chocolate markings on its parapodia as well.
This specimen was quite good and regular at flying! Constantly flapping it's parapodial wings.
